Introduction The Mechanic position provides performance of semi-skilled, skilled, and administrative work in maintaining the vehicles and mechanical equipment of the Public Works Department and various other Village departments. The work includes preventative maintenance, servicing, and repair of a wide variety of motor vehicles, construction equipment, and small engine equipment. Work also involves performing routine maintenance of building mechanical systems including HVAC, electrical, and plumbing. On occasion, the position is also required to perform the same tasks assigned to a Public Works Crewperson, including snow plowing.
Position Summary Tests, diagnoses, services and repairs vehicles and mechanical equipment including but not limited to large dump trucks, back hoes, skid loaders, loaders, pickup trucks, fire trucks, ambulances, police squads, mowers, tractors, portable and stationary generators, plows, wings, sanders, string trimmers, chain saws, etc. Determines the most cost-effective means of maintenance, repair, or replacement and reports to Supervisor. Performs preventive maintenance for all vehicles and mechanical equipment following a prescribed maintenance schedule. Repairs tires, brakes, engines, electrical, fuel, hydraulic, transmission, ignition, air, exhaust, axle assemblies, suspension, air conditioning and related systems. Performs light body repair, touch up and related work. Provides emergency field assistance to disabled equipment as needed. Purchases equipment, parts, and supplies used for vehicle and mechanical system maintenance within prescribed guidelines. Coordinates parts inventory under the direction of Supervisor. Follows shop procedures and budget data for the maintenance and repair of vehicles and mechanical systems set by the Supervisor. Assists in the preparation of bid specifications for vehicles and mechanical equipment. Designs and modifies Public Works equipment with the guidance of Supervisor. Coordinates DOT pre trip/post trip vehicle inspections, including follow up repairs, documentation and related tasks under supervision. Maintains records, prepares reports and other specialized maintenance records for vehicles and other related equipment. Assists in the preparation of budgets. Operates a wide variety of diagnostic tools, all basic hand tools, electrically powered tools, pneumatic tools, lifts and related equipment in a safe manner. Performs cutting, welding and fabrication to snow removal equipment, turf maintenance equipment and all other Village owned facilities and equipment. Qualifications The qualified candidate will possess the following education and experience:
High school diploma or GED equivalency; Completion of a full-time training program in automotive or diesel mechanics; 3 to 5 years of related experience in maintenance and repair of cars, trucks, construction equipment, and small engine; or, Any combination of education and experience which in the sole discretion of the Village would demonstrate the Employee's ability to meet the required knowledge, skills, and abilities for the position. Candidate must possess or be able to obtain a valid Wisconsin drivers' license with applicable Commercial Driver's License (CDL) endorsements.
